Understanding Heat Exchange Technology
Heat exchange espresso machines run on a special principle that enables synchronised water heating for brewing and steaming. Automatic Espresso Machines are equipped with a single boiler that utilizes a heat exchanger system. This feature is considerable as it enables users to brew espresso while steaming milk concurrently, promoting effectiveness in the coffee-making procedure.
How Does a Heat Exchange Espresso Machine Work?
The procedure begins with the machine's water inlet filling the boiler. As Pump Espresso Machines warms up, it turns to steam. The ingenious heat exchanger utilizes hot steam to heat additional water in a different passage designed specifically for the brew group. This implies that water can reach the perfect brewing temperature level without awaiting the boiler to change. The crucial steps consist of:
- Water Fill: Water is drawn into the boiler.
- Heating Process: The boiler warms up as water is converted into steam.
- Heat Exchange: Steam heats water in the heat exchanger tube.
- Brewing: Water from the heat exchanger is pressed through coffee premises, drawing out the flavors needed for a rich espresso.
This procedure enables fast temperature level adjustments and enhanced coffee extraction.

FAQs About Heat Exchange Espresso Machines
What is the main difference between a heat exchange and a dual boiler espresso machine?
While both types can brew espresso and steam milk at the same time, dual boiler machines have different boilers for brewing and steaming. On the other hand, heat exchange machines make use of a single boiler and a heat exchanger to achieve the exact same function.

What kind of maintenance do heat exchange espresso machines need?
Regular maintenance consists of descaling, cleaning the boiler, inspecting seals and gaskets, and keeping the group head tidy. Regular upkeep ensures durability and constant efficiency.
